OpenType incrustadas ( EOT ) fuentes son una forma compacta de OpenType fuentes diseñadas por Microsoft para su uso como fuentes incrustadas en las páginas web . Estos archivos usan la extensión .eot
. Solo son compatibles con Microsoft Internet Explorer , a diferencia de los archivos WOFF de la competencia .
Extensión de nombre de archivo | .eot |
---|---|
Tipo de medio de Internet | application / vnd.ms-fontobject |
Tipo de formato | fuente de contorno |
Descripción general
Los archivos de fuentes EOT se pueden crear a partir de archivos de fuentes TrueType existentes utilizando la Herramienta de fuentes de incrustación web de Microsoft (WEFT) y otro software patentado y de código abierto (consulte "Enlaces externos" a continuación).
Los ficheros se hacen pequeños en tamaño mediante el uso de subconjuntos de (sólo incluyendo los caracteres necesarios), y por la compresión de datos (compresión LZ, parte de Agfa 's MicroType expreso ). Al igual que las fuentes OTF, EOT admite contornos PostScript y TrueType para los glifos. [1]
El simple hecho de incluir fuentes en páginas web puede llevar a la copia sin restricciones de archivos de fuentes con derechos de autor. OpenType incrustado incluye funciones para desalentar la copia. El subconjunto reduce el valor de la copia, ya que las fuentes subconjunto normalmente omitirán más de la mitad de los caracteres. Otras medidas de protección de copia utilizadas son el cifrado y una lista de "raíces confiables" en el extremo de origen, y una biblioteca de descifrado de propiedad en el extremo receptor.
Si la fuente incrustada no está disponible para la página web por algún motivo (falta el archivo de fuente, claves incorrectas en el archivo, no es compatible con el navegador web), entonces se utiliza la especificación de fuente de segunda opción, asegurando que la página debe ser legible incluso sin la fuente deseada.
Embedded OpenType es un estándar patentado compatible exclusivamente con Internet Explorer, pero se envió al W3C en 2007 como parte de CSS3 , que fue rechazado y reenviado como presentación independiente el 18 de marzo de 2008 . El comentario del equipo del W3C sobre la presentación establece que "el W3C planea presentar una propuesta a los miembros del W3C para un grupo de trabajo cuyo objetivo es tratar de desarrollar EOT en una recomendación del W3C". Sin embargo, el W3C finalmente eligió un formato de fuente web diferente ( WOFF ) como recomendación del W3C. [2] La compatibilidad con el formato no se ha integrado en Microsoft Edge , el sucesor de Internet Explorer.
Herramienta de fuentes de incrustación web
La herramienta de fuentes web incrustables, o WEFT, es la utilidad de Microsoft para generar fuentes web incrustables .
Los webmasters utilizan WEFT para crear 'objetos de fuente' que están vinculados a sus páginas web para que los usuarios que utilicen el navegador web Internet Explorer de Microsoft vean las páginas mostradas en el estilo de fuente contenido en el objeto de fuente.
WEFT escanea los archivos de documentos HTML , los archivos de fuentes TrueType y algunos parámetros adicionales. Ajusta los archivos HTML y crea archivos OpenType incrustados para su inclusión en el sitio web. Estos archivos suelen utilizar la extensión ' .eot
'.
WEFT puede incrustar la mayoría de las fuentes, pero no incrustará fuentes que sus diseñadores hayan designado como fuentes "no incrustadas". WEFT puede rechazar otras fuentes porque se han identificado problemas.
En el pasado, las fuentes integradas se usaban ampliamente para generar sitios web en idiomas distintos del inglés.
A partir de enero de 2015, la versión más reciente de la herramienta (WEFT 3.2) se lanzó el 25 de febrero de 2003. A partir de 2019, Microsoft ya no ofrece la herramienta para su descarga.
Una alternativa de código abierto es ' ttf2eot '.
Microsoft PowerPoint 2007 y 2010 también generan archivos .eot con la extensión '.fntdata' [1] cuando la aplicación cliente de PowerPoint selecciona fuentes para incrustarlas en una presentación. Estos archivos .eot pueden extraerse del archivo '.pptx' y usarse directamente en las páginas web.
Temas de seguridad
La actualización de seguridad crítica para Windows Vista KB969947 resuelve varios problemas de seguridad que "podrían permitir la ejecución remota de código si un usuario ve el contenido representado en una fuente Embedded OpenType (EOT) especialmente diseñada". Dichas fuentes podrían integrarse en sitios web, incluidos aquellos que alojan contenido proporcionado por el usuario. [3]
Ver también
Referencias
enlaces externos
- Tipografía de Microsoft: incrustación de fuentes para la web
- Tipografía de Microsoft: herramienta de fuentes de incrustación web
- EOT-utils - software gratuito de código abierto para crear fuentes EOT por W3C
- ttf2eot : software gratuito de código abierto para convertir fuentes de TTF a EOT
- CSS2: fuentes
- Tabla de compatibilidad para el soporte de fuentes EOT en navegadores
- Presentación del W3C que describe el formato
- Acta del Grupo de trabajo de fuentes del W3C, 23 de octubre de 2008
- Registro MIME
- Fuentes web de Google